Beachfront hotel for sun and fun At Naqalia Lodge, hit the beach where you can enjoy snorkeling, then dine onsite at Onsite venue. Naqalia Lodge offers 4 accommodations with ceiling fans. Rooms open to patios. Bathrooms include showers. Housekeeping is provided daily. The recreational activities listed below are available either on site or nearby; fees may apply.
Children are welcome. cribs (infant beds) are not available.

Summary: We have left a piece of our heart at Naqalia Lodge and at the Yasawa Island. The staff and Management at Naqalia went above and beyond to make our stay nothing short of amazing and they were always smiling and happy to help. We stayed in the garden Bure, a traditional Fijian house, which was a pretty authentic experience of the life on the island. The food was home cooked, traditional and always in very generous portions. We sat at the table with the other guests and were a "family -like" meal times while the staff and management was playing guitar and singing songs for us.
The lodge is on the beach surrounded by nature at the feet of a mountain, you can enjoy a spectacular view of the other island when you wake up with the sounds of chicken and roosters roaming around the Bure. The coral reefs just off the beach are SPECTACULAR, we could see many tropical fish of every colour, size and shape. It definitely was one of the best snorkeling spots that we have been to. The lodge offers also paid activities such as shark feeding, fishing and village visit. We spent 4 days there but we really wished we could stay more. Vinaka.

Summary: What a magic place in the world. Naqalia Lodge might be the best place I ever stayed and God knows I have been traveling! It is not a 5 star hotel and the accommodations are very simple but you have everything you need. Sleeping with the wind on your face and the sound of waves, mosquitoes nets everywhere for you to be well. This I will miss a lot. Showers are cold but you don’t really need hot showers as the temperature is quite warm even in the evenings.
The spot in itself is for everyone else that stayed here while I was there including me, the best snorkeling spot we’ve seen so far with the most amazing plate corals with all types of colors. Incredible!
The activities are great between fishing, hiking (steep climbs!), going to the village is also a must to meet the children. You never get bored and have time to relax during your day and snorkel all day!
The meal plan is perfect, you are never hungry and the food is good. Breakfast is the best!!
And finally, the kindness, the continuous efforts of the team to make you happy, to make you feel at home but also to get to know you and share their history and culture with you. Oni, Sia, Aku, Manu, Mana, Toui a very big THANK YOU. I will remember your kindness and generosity forever!
